THE “BREADCRUMB” NETWORK
Vowbound engineers have proposed what NSD documentation informally describes as a breadcrumb communications architecture.
The concept is straightforward.
The expedition begins with a reliable connection to the primary command station.
As the Vigilants move deeper underground, dedicated relay nodes are periodically installed behind them.
Each node connects to the previous node.
The result becomes:
Command Station → Relay 1 → Relay 2 → Relay 3 → Relay 4 → Expedition
The expedition therefore does not need to establish a direct radio connection through kilometers of rock.
It only needs to maintain a connection with the nearest relay node.
As terrain, tunnel geometry, electromagnetic interference or distance begins degrading communications, the survey units deploy another relay.
The network grows with the expedition.
